Verdict

CHINA IN YOUR HAND promises to have derived plenty from an eye-catching debut at Doncaster and is taken to strike at the second time of asking. Necromancer is bred to come into her own over longer trips, but is in excellent hands and commands respect, especially if the market speaks in her favour. Another newcomer worthy of consideration is Flooding, whose sire continues to make an excellent impression with his progeny.

Horse Racing Basic Terms

Exacta

A bet selecting the first and second horses in a race in the correct order. An exacta box refers to paying a little more to ensure they can finish in either order.

Furlong

One furlong is an eighth of a mile.

Firm

A dry turf course, equal to a ‘fast’ dirt track.
